Engineering Compliance and Certification Requirements for Structural Hollow Sections

Structural hollow sections used in load-bearing frames must comply with recognized engineering codes — EN 1993 for European projects, AISC 360 for North American specifications, and local building codes across Belt & Road markets. The seamless square and rectangular steel tube in S355JR grade meets EN 10210 requirements for hot-finished structural hollow sections, while Q345 aligns with GB/T 1591 for Chinese-standard projects. For projects requiring CE marking, our production follows EN 10210 and EN 10219 with Factory Production Control certified under ISO 9001 [NEED_CITE: CE marking requirements for structural steel hollow sections under EN 1090-2]. Surface treatment selection — hot rolled for indoor or painted environments, galvanized for outdoor or coastal exposure — must be specified at inquiry stage because coating type affects both the inspection protocol and the packing method during ocean transit.

Steel Grade Selection and Seamless Manufacturing Process Explained

The Q-series (Q195, Q235, Q345) follows the Chinese GB standard system where the number indicates minimum yield strength in MPa. The S-series (S235JR, S275JR, S355JR) follows the European EN standard with equivalent yield strength levels and standardized impact testing at 20°C for the JR designation. ASTM A53 and A106 cover the North American specification framework. When a project specification calls for S355JR, our Q345 grade provides equivalent mechanical properties and is widely accepted as a substitute in international procurement — but the mill test certificate must document the actual chemistry and mechanical results to satisfy the engineer of record.

The seamless manufacturing process for these square and rectangular hollow sections begins with solid round billets that are pierced and elongated through a mandrel mill, then shaped into square or rectangular profiles through a series of forming rolls. Unlike ERW tubes where the longitudinal weld seam creates a potential weakness under dynamic loading, seamless tubes maintain uniform grain structure around the entire cross-section. This makes them preferred for scaffolding uprights and machinery frames where repeated load cycling occurs. Hot rolled finish provides a mill scale surface suitable for painting, while galvanized coating adds zinc protection for corrosive environments — the choice depends on the project’s environmental exposure classification.

Hidden Costs of Procuring Non-Compliant Seamless Square and Rectangular Steel Tube

Sourcing seamless square and rectangular steel tubes from traders who blend inventory from multiple mills creates three categories of hidden cost. First, material traceability breaks down — the mill test certificate may reference a heat number that cannot be verified against the physical markings on the tube, causing customs holds or third-party inspection failures at the destination port [NEED_CITE: material traceability requirements for structural steel under EN 10204]. Second, mixed-grade shipments where S235JR tubes are substituted for S355JR without documentation create structural safety liability if the engineer’s calculations assumed higher yield strength. Third, excessive negative tolerance — where actual wall thickness falls below the minimum allowed by standard — means the buyer pays for steel that does not meet the specified load capacity, leading to rejection during structural inspection or forced replacement at the contractor’s expense.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How do Q235 and Q345 steel grades correspond to S235JR and S355JR in European specifications?

A: Q235 and S235JR share similar minimum yield strength levels around 235 MPa and are widely accepted as equivalent in international structural projects. Q345 corresponds to S355JR with minimum yield strength around 345-355 MPa. Our mill test certificates document the actual chemical composition and mechanical test results for each heat, allowing your engineer to verify compliance with the project specification regardless of which designation system is used [NEED_CITE: steel grade equivalence tables between GB EN and ASTM standards].

Q: When should I specify hot rolled finish versus galvanized coating for seamless square and rectangular steel tubes?

A: Hot rolled finish with mill scale is appropriate for indoor structural frames, machinery components, or projects where the tubes will receive a painted or powder-coated finish on site. Galvanized coating is specified for outdoor exposure, coastal environments, or applications where ongoing maintenance access is limited — such as scaffolding systems, highway gantry frames, and agricultural building structures. The galvanizing process adds a zinc layer that provides sacrificial corrosion protection, and we perform coating thickness inspection on every galvanized batch to verify compliance with the specified micron requirement.
